Barbecued Meatloaf
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 15 Minutes
Cook Time: 60 Minutes
Ready In: 75 Minutes
Servings: 8
This is a wonderful meatloaf that my grandmother always makes. It is a little different than a traditional meat loaf, because it is not real firm. But it is oh so good. (Makes great sandwiches the next day,too)
Ingredients:
1 1/2 lbs ground chuck (or beef, but it will be fattier)
1 cup fresh breadcrumb
1 medium onion, diced
1 egg
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ce
1 (6 ounce) can tomato paste
3 tablespoons vinegar
3 tablespoons brown sugar
2 tablespoons prepared mustard
2 tablespoons worcestershire sauce
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F.
2. Mix together beef, bread crumbs, onion, egg, salt, pepper, sauce and paste.
3. Put into a 9x13 glass dish.
4. Spread flat and then make some shallow holes in the top with a spoon.
5. Mix together vinegar, brown sugar, mustard and Worcestershire.
6. Pour over the top of loaf.
7. Bake for 1 hour.
8. You may need to spoon off some of the fat about 15 minutes before the cooking time is over.
